What if everything you've been told about balance is wrong? In this episode of the Wholistic Productivity Podcast, Chris LeBrun breaks down why the "perfect pie chart" version of balance is setting you up to feel like a failure — and what to replace it with instead. The answer isn't more discipline or better time management. It's rhythm.

Chris shares a candid look at his own heavy seasons as a nonprofit fundraiser and how leaning intentionally into one area of life — then consciously shifting back — is what real balance actually looks like over time.

Whether you're feeling stretched thin right now or just stuck in a season that was never supposed to be permanent, this episode will give you a fresh framework for how to think about balance — and a challenge to figure out which season you're actually in.
